Nutrition Comparison
| Per 100g | Sweet Corn | Cucumber |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 86kcal | 15kcal |
| Protein | 3.3g | 0.7g |
| Carbs | 19g | 3.6g |
| Fat | 1.4g | 0.1g |
| Fiber | 2.7g | 0.5g |
| Sugar | 3.2g | 1.7g |
| Sodium | 15mg | 2mg |
Green marks the more favorable value (fewer calories/sugar/sodium, more protein/fiber).
Key Takeaways
- Cucumber has 71 fewer calories per 100g than Sweet Corn (473% less).
- Sweet Corn delivers more protein (3.3g vs 0.7g per 100g).
- Sweet Corn has more fiber (2.7g vs 0.5g).
- Cucumber contains less fat (0.1g vs 1.4g).
- Cucumber has less sugar (1.7g vs 3.2g).
Sweet Corn
Sweet corn is a starchy vegetable supplying fiber, B vitamins and the carotenoids lutein and zeaxanthin that support eye health. It is more energy-dense than most vegetables, sitting closer to a grain in carbohydrate content.
